Tools employed

A professional locksmith has a wide range tools that can be utilized to accomplish a variety of tasks. This includes repair and maintenance of locks. Certain tools are more advanced than others.

A key extractor can, for instance, be used to extract broken keys from locks. A laser key cutter is another tool that is useful. It is able to cut a variety of types of keys.

A safe scope and a lock are two additional tools. They are a great accessory to a locksmith's toolbox. They are great for viewing the lock when you pick it. Additionally, the ideal scope should provide a powerful beam of light.

Another helpful tool for a locksmith is a plug spinner. This tool allows one to rotate a lock into the correct position. Numerous locksmiths in the profession utilize this tool.

The slim jim is among the most popular and oldest tools for opening doors in cars. It can be inserted through the window to the door of a car. Slim jims come in a variety of sizes and shapes.

Lock picks are a vital tool for unlocking your car. They are available as electric or manual. Both are safe when used correctly. The most important thing to remember when using a pick is to prevent breaking a lock.

A duplicate key can be purchased from an agent

A dealership may be able to provide an original key if you require an additional key for your car. However, it can be costly to have a car key copied by a dealer. Prices vary depending on type and model of the vehicle. It could cost as high as $150, and some vehicles might require a trip to near the dealership to get there.

If you're looking for a cost-effective alternative, it's possible to copy your car key at the local hardware store. This is the simplest option if you're searching for the car key in an emergency. You can take your current keys or make use of the machine to create a duplicate. It's important to keep in mind that the staff at the hardware store may not have the expertise required to assist you.

If you're in search of an ordinary car key or a transponder-style key it's essential to know how to get duplicate keys. Most auto dealers do not replace the basic car keys, however, they do accept keys for newer cars with transponders as well as key fobs. You can get the replacement key for your car at a dealership, but you will need to pay for towing. The dealer will pair your vehicle with a new computer chip. This can take several days, depending on the vehicle.
